NCAA Div. I Men: Harvard Leads Princeton After Day One of Easterns

CAMBRIDGE, MA., Feb. 28. DEFENDING men's Eastern League champ Harvard leads after the first day of this season's championship meet at the Crimson's Blodgett Pool.

Coach Tim Murphy's Harvard squad racked up 461 points to 421 for second-place Princeton, coached by former USC All-America Rob Orr, who has guided the Tigers to six Eastern [Ivy] Championships during his 23-year stay on the New Jersey campus.

Harvard was runner-up to Princeton in both the 200 free (1:20.29-1:20.89) and 400 medley relays (3:15.03-3:16.25) but scored wins by soph John Cole in the 500 free (NCAA "B" cut 4:21.13) and a one-two sweep of the 200 IM (junior Dan Shevchik first, 1:48.38; freshman Ryan Smith second, 1:49.93). Both swims are NCAA "B" cuts too.

Brown's Jeff Miksis (1:50.38) was third while Princeton's Chris Cunningham (1:50.91) followed.

Cole was fifth at last year's NCAAs in the 1650 free (pr and Crimson school-record 14:49.48), knocking some seconds off the old record of 14:56+ by Bobby Hackett from nearly a quarter-century ago. Hackett was silver medalist in the 1500 free at the Montreal Olympics in '76.

Tiger junior Jesse Gage won his second-straight 50 free crown with an NCAA "B" cut of 20.08 while Navy's Brett Cline was silver-medalist (20.43) and Harvard's Bard Burns was third (20.51). The NCAA "B" cut is 20.33

Yale (Josh Gallant), Princeton (Josh DeMond) and Harvard (Enrique Roy went one-two-three on the 1-meter borad and Princeton broke Harvard's meet record in the medley relay (3:15.20 from last year) with its 3:15.03.

The Tigers' Pat Donohue led off in 49.52, followed by Garth Fealy, Carl Hessler and Gage on the anchor (with a fast 43.25 split).

Gage is also double-defending 100 fly champ and holds the Eastern record with a 47.84 from the '00 Championship.
